Summary

Senate Resolution 880 is a commemorative bill in memory of Antonio A. Torres, Sr., a longtime justice of the peace from Brownsville, Texas. The resolution acknowledges his 23 years of dedicated service to the community, emphasizing his roles as a police officer and probation officer in addition to his judicial career. The bill recognizes not only his professional achievements but also his involvement in various community organizations, reflecting the high esteem in which he was held by the citizens of Brownsville.
